Y2.01K bug trips up symantec: error causes red faces

Published January 5, 2010

Symantec's Endpoint Protection Manager has been hit by a classic date bug and fell over at the end of the year, accepting no definition updates dated since then.

Symantec has issued a statement saying: "An issue has been identified in the Symantec Endpoint Protection Manager server whereby all types of SEP definition content with a date greater than December 31, 2009 11:59pm are considered to be 'out of date'."

Until the bug is fixed, Symantec has a "bandaid" strategy;Symantec Response will continue to publish Symantec Endpoint Protection antivirus and other definitions with the date 12/31/2009, and will only increase the revision number of the definition.
